1. Athens Riviera Trikke Bike Tour & Vouliagmeni Lake

Experience the beauty of the Athenian Riviera from a 3-wheel, electric vehicle on a safe and innovative 2.5-hour tour. Perfect for couples, groups, and families with kids, the specially designed vehicles will deliver you to the most beautiful beaches of Athens with ease. Start with a brief safety orientation briefing to ensure you feel confident operating the vehicle. Then, ride the narrow and sandy isthmus that connects Kavouri Beach to the mainland en route to Vouliagmeni Lake. Sunk in the remains of a huge limestone cave that is fed by lukewarm springs, the silly, brackish waters of the lake are said to have healing properties for rheumatism and arthritis. Along the way, sink your toes in the sandy beaches tucked between rocky shores.
